Job Summary

We are seeking a highly skilled Pharmacist-Clinical Staff PRN I to join our team at Baptist Memorial Health Care.

Responsibilities
  • Manage medication orders, ensuring medication safety and age-specific considerations.
  • Participate in pharmacotherapeutic plan processes and contribute to goals, programs, and report cards for the unit/department/hospital.
  • Supervise and direct healthcare team members, process and prepare sterile products for dispensing, and provide drug information and education.
  • Participate actively on inter and intra-departmental committees and maximize safety and efficiency through appropriate use of automation.
  • Complete assigned goals and maintain a high level of professionalism and expertise.
Requirements
  • Minimum: Bachelor of Science (B.S.) or Doctor of Pharmacy (Ph.D.) degree.
  • Preferred: One year of hospital pharmacy experience.
  • Minimum: PHARMACIST-FOR APPROPRIATE STATE licensure.
  • Preferred: Advanced computer order entry literacy, Microsoft Office applications, clinical experience, and BLS and/or ACLS certification.
